About Junjie Ge
Junjie Ge is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Electrochemistry and Process Chemistry and Technology, having authored 201 papers that have together received 12.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(164 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(121 papers), Advanced battery technologies research (63 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(36 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(23 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(15 papers), CO2 Reduction Techniques and Catalysts (15 papers) and Carbon dioxide utilization in catalysis (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(10.2k citations), Electrochemistry (1.4k cit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(7.8k citations), Catalysis (896 citations) and Process Chemistry and Technology (357 citations). Junjie Ge has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Changpeng Liu, Wei Xing, Meiling Xiao, Jianbing Zhu, Xian Wang, Zheng Jiang, Liqin Gao, Zhaoping Shi, Hao Zhang and Ying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Materials Chemistry A, Nano Research, Journal of Energy Chemistry, Electrochimica Acta and International Journal of Hydrogen Energy.
